Don't forget that this Sunday (July 16) is National Ice Cream Day.It was actually in 1984, that President Ronald Reagan designated the third Sunday in July as National Ice Cream Day, and called for people to observe the day with "appropriate ceremonies and activities."
So, it's not some lop-sided shindig that one company came up with.
That means it's our patriotic duty to pay homage to that great American institution: little boys and girls slurping ice cream cones on a hot July weekend.
